About the Role
This individual will drive compliance strategy, manage risk assessments, support client audits, and ensure continuous alignment with evolving regulatory and industry standards.
What You’ll Do- Vulnerability Management (Tenable)
- Implement and manage Tenable Vulnerability Management solutions across enterprise systems.
- Conduct regular vulnerability scans, analyze results, and provide remediation.
- Collaborate with IT and security teams to prioritize and mitigate risks.
- Data Security – Microsoft Purview IRM
- Configure and administer MS Purview IRM policies to protect sensitive data.
- Define and enforce access controls, encryption, and data usage restrictions.
- Support compliance initiatives by aligning IRM activities with regulatory requirements (GDPR, HIPAA, etc.).
- Data Security – Cyera DSPM
- Deploy and manage Cyera DSPM tools to monitor and secure structured and unstructured data.
- Identify sensitive data across cloud and on-prem environments, ensuring proper classification and protection.
- Provide insights into data exposure risks and recommend corrective actions.
- Consulting & Advisory
- Advise stakeholders on best practices for vulnerability management and data security.
- Conduct risk assessments and deliver actionable recommendations.
- Support incident response and remediation efforts when security events occur.
- Proven experience with Tenable Vulnerability Management (configuration, reporting, remediation workflows).
- Hands‑on expertise with Microsoft Purview IRM (policy creation, data classification, encryption).
- Practical knowledge of Cyera DSPM (deployment, monitoring, risk analysis).
- Strong understanding of data governance, compliance frameworks, and cybersecurity standards.
- Ability to communicate complex security concepts to both technical and non‑technical stakeholders.
- Experience in consulting or advisory roles within data security and risk management.
Simeio has over 650 talented employees across the globe. We have offices in the USA (Atlanta HQ and Texas), India, Canada, Costa Rica, and the UK.
Founded in 2007 and now backed by private equity company ZMC, Simeio is recognized as a top IAM provider by industry analysts.
Alongside Simeio’s identity orchestration tool ‘Simeio IO’, Simeio also partners with industry‑leading IAM software vendors to provide access management, identity governance and administration, privileged access management, and risk intelligence services across on‑premise, cloud, and hybrid technology environments.
Simeio provides services to numerous Fortune 1000 companies across all industries including financial services, technology, healthcare, media, retail, public sector, utilities, and education.
